WebA money transmitter surety bond is a type of license and permit bond which money transmitters need in order to get licensed in their state. Almost all states, with few exceptions, require such bonds upon licensing. The bond’s purpose and function is to protect the public and the state from theft and fraud by dishonest money transmitters.
